Google Wallet unable to set up

ANSWERED

Hello, I would really like to use the google pay feature on my Fitbit charge 6. However, whenever I am trying to set up a the card, when it sayings contacting/connecting to bank, it then says An unexpected error has occurred, please try again later. Then when I leave the google wallet tile on the Fitbit app on my iPhone, and re-enter the google wallet tile, the card appears. However when I check my charge 6, the card is not on the Watch. Has anyone else experienced this? And any fixes? I am on the latest update on the tracker, and I have tried multiple times to connect the card. (I am using CIBC btw)

I upgraded to a more current iPhone and Fitbit app did not transfer over smoothly with out some problems.  Apple iOS 18.1 forced me to redo the following above method again to restore my Fitbit with the same data.  I had to delete Fitbit from my current iPhone in the Fitbit app and remove also from iPhone settings Bluetooth, choose forget this device option. I login on the same modern android phone that I had from the above posts.  I login capital one banking app, login Google wallet  and without changing any options but accepting all defaults by each app. Then,  I went to Fitbit device and went to settings to look for restore to default/clear data to remove,  restore Fitbit to the first day it was opened out of the box.  I then log in Fitbit app on the android phone and use my same google account login from the same iPhone Fitbit app email login. I added my Fitbit and type the numbers that appear after Fitbit found screen.  A pop up appears after typing Fitbit number saying pair Fitbit and allow Bluetooth, I was not paying attention for a few seconds so had to press try again to see message. After pairing is done , I synced the Fitbit to make sure everything works. Then, I went to Fitbit wallet tile and enter my credit card info and it says contacting bank, banking app running in the background pops up with message saying google wallet asking for permission to add to Fitbit, message says agree or decline, I click yes and then Fitbit app says Authorization/permission received and continuing setting up Google wallet/Google pay. Fitbit says Google wallet is ready and I go to sync Fitbit and check my Fitbit on my wrist to confirm.  I type in my passcode to check if Google wallet shows up on the Fitbit and I am happy again.  I did not provide the exact wording from each message/notice or setting but most Fitbit users are already familiar with  Fitbit login, pairing and syncing and Fitbit/Google wallet.  I  hope everyone resolves their Fitbit digital payment problem.
